Gas-Phase Oxidation of Alcohols over Alkali-Magnesium Orthophosphates
In this work we synthesized catalytic solids by digesting freshly prepared magnesium orthophosphate with a saturated solution of alkali carbonates. The solids thus formed were mixed orthophosphates of structure X MgPO4 (X = Li, Na, K) that were characterized by X-ray diffraction and diffuse reflectance IR spectroscopy. Ali of them exhibited a high activity and selectivity in the conversion of primary and secondary alcohols into their corresponding carbonyl compounds. Their activity and selectivity are compared with that of X MgPO4 orthophosphates (X = Li, Na, K) obtained from a dry phase.
